So who was Jonno Highway? Jonno was not a nice man (Credit: BBC) Who was Jonno Highway exactly? As some recalled, Jonno Highway was Stuart and Callum’s father. Played by Richard Graham, Jonno first (and last) appeared in 2019, after being contacted by Callum’s then-fiancée, Whitney Dean. A virulent homophobe, first Jonno clashed with the Mitchells after making a foul comment about gay Pride. It was later revealed that Jonno had not been a good father to his sons, and had even been violent toward Stuart in the past. He didn’t take the news that Callum had come out as gay at all well, and blamed Ben for turning his son into ‘one of them.’ During the ensuing confrontation, Jonno copped a punch from Phil, who leapt to his son’s defense in typically violent Mitchell manner.
